The XDMA7600 inclues advanced audio control to provide superior adjustability in the
sound output. These adjustments include:
• Center Frequency - focuses bass, mid, and treble adjustments around a specific frequency.
• Quality ("Q") Factor - narrows or expands the bass or mid bandwidth around the center
frequency.
• Low Pass Filters - removes mid and treble frequencies from the subwoofer RCA outputs.
These advanced audio controls are located as sub-menu items in the audio menu as
shown below.

Press AUDIO/MENU until BASS appears. Then press
SELECT until BAS FREQ appears. Rotate the volume knob
to adjust (50Hz - 100Hz - 200Hz).
Press AUDIO/MENU until MIDDLE appears. Then press
SELECT until MID FREQ appears. Rotate the volume knob
to adjust (0.5kHz - 1kHz - 2.0kHz).
Press AUDIO/MENU until TREBLE appears. Then press
SELECT until TRE FREQ appears. Rotate the volume knob
to adjust (5kHz - 10kHz - 15kHz).
Press AUDIO/MENU until BASS appears. Then press
SELECT twice until BAS Q appears. Rotate the volume knob
to adjust (0.7 - 1.0 - 1.4 - 2.0).
Press AUDIO/MENU until MIDDLE appears. Then press
SELECT twice until MID Q appears. Rotate the volume knob
to adjust (0.7 - 1.0 - 1.4 - 2.0).
Press AUDIO/MENU until TREBLE appears. Then press
SELECT twice until TRE Q appears. Rotate the volume knob
to adjust (0.7 - 1.0 - 1.4 - 2.0).
Press AUDIO/MENU until SUBWFR appears. Then press
SELECT until SUB LPF appears. Rotate the volume knob to
adjust (FULL - 55Hz - 85Hz - 120Hz).
Note: When using the LPF feature, set any crossover on
the amplifier to full range or off, to avoid filtering of audio
frequencies twice.
